The Truth About Height Growth and Nutrition


Height is influenced by genetics, lifestyle, sleep, physical activity, and most importantly, nutrition. While genetics determine a large part of your potential height, the right nutrients help your body maximize its natural growth during childhood, adolescence, and the teenage years.


A balanced diet supports healthy bone development, muscle growth, hormone production, and overall physical development. Let's explore the essential nutrients that contribute to height growth.


1. Protein – The Building Block of Growth



Protein plays a vital role in tissue repair, muscle development, and the production of growth hormones. A protein-rich diet supports healthy growth and development.


Best Sources:


Eggs


Chicken


Fish


Milk


Greek yogurt


Paneer


Lentils and beans


Soy products



2. Calcium – Strong Bones, Better Growth



Calcium is one of the most important minerals for developing strong and healthy bones. Without adequate calcium, bones may not reach their full growth potential.


Best Sources:


Milk and dairy products


Cheese


Yogurt


Sesame seeds


Almonds


Green leafy vegetables



3. Vitamin D – The Calcium Absorber



Vitamin D helps the body absorb calcium efficiently. A deficiency can affect bone growth and strength.


Best Sources:


Morning sunlight


Fatty fish


Egg yolks


Fortified dairy products



4. Zinc – Growth Hormone Support



Zinc is essential for cell growth, immune function, and the production of growth hormones. Studies have shown that zinc deficiency may negatively impact growth in children and adolescents.


Best Sources:


Pumpkin seeds


Nuts


Beans


Seafood


Whole grains



5. Magnesium – Bone Development Booster



Magnesium supports bone density and helps regulate many biological processes related to growth.


Best Sources:


Spinach


Nuts


Seeds


Whole grains


Dark chocolate



6. Vitamin K – Bone Strength and Health



Vitamin K helps maintain healthy bone metabolism and supports proper bone mineralization.


Best Sources:


Kale


Broccoli


Spinach


Cabbage



7. Healthy Carbohydrates and Fats



The body needs energy to grow. Healthy carbohydrates and fats provide fuel for growth, physical activity, and hormone production.


Best Sources:


Brown rice


Oats


Sweet potatoes


Avocados


Nuts


Olive oil



Lifestyle Habits That Support Height Growth



Nutrition alone is not enough. Combine a healthy diet with:


✅ 8–10 hours of quality sleep

✅ Regular exercise and sports

✅ Stretching and mobility exercises

✅ Proper hydration

✅ Good posture habits


Foods to Avoid



Limit:


Excessive junk food


Sugary beverages


Highly processed snacks


Excessive fast food consumption



These foods may contribute to poor nutrition and reduced overall health.


Final Thoughts


Growing taller naturally requires a combination of proper nutrition, adequate sleep, physical activity, and healthy lifestyle habits. Focus on protein, calcium, vitamin D, zinc, and other essential nutrients to support your body's growth potential.


Remember, height is largely determined by genetics, but a nutrient-rich lifestyle helps ensure you achieve your maximum natural growth.
